From 1951 onwards, Balerno was expanded with the creation of a new housing estate under the builders
Mactaggart & Mickel. In 1975, the village became part of the city of Edinburgh. Also in 1975, part of the village was designated as a conservation area (with the boundaries enlarged in 1997). In

2013 saw the launch of
Balerno Village Screen - a community cinema project with free admission and funded by donations. The screenings are shown monthly on the first Saturday of every month in the Ogston Hall and the St Joseph's Centre. So far around 400 villagers have turned out per screening to

Harmeny School is a grant-aided special school for primary school aged children with social, emotional and behavioural difficulties that was established in 1958. As well as new buildings, part of the school occupies the former
Mansfield House, a Category B listed Scottish

Edinburgh. The line saw an upsurge in housebuilding in Balerno. The last passenger train to run on the line was in 1943, and a High School was placed on the site of the goods station in 1983. The line runs adjacent to the Water of Leith river.

operates an Animal Rescue and
Rehoming Centre on Mansfield Rd in Balerno. The SSPCA opened the centre in 1930 as a Rest Farm for working horses. The centre cares for and rehomes thousands of neglected and mistreated animals every year.

2008 saw the launch of
Balerno's music festival with events held at Balerno Parish Church, Balerno Bowling Club, Balerno Parish Church New Hall, the Grey Horse Inn and the St Joseph's Centre.

Balerno Bowling Club situated in the heart of the village dates back to 1885, plays lawn bowls in the Water of Leith league, Edinburgh & Leith Bowling Association.
